(KNZA)-- A Jackson County man has been arrested three times since May on sex-related charges.
Jackson County Attorney Shawna Miller says 21-year-old Jacob Ewing turned himself in to authorities Friday morning in the lastest case.
That comes after a warrant was issued Thursday charging Ewing with attempted rape, aggravated sexual battery and battery for alleged incidents occurring in January 2014.
Miller says Ewing was initially arrested May 6th on charges of rape, aggravated criminal sodomy, battery and other offenses against an 18-year-old female allegedly occurring that day. He posted a $75,000 bond in the case the same day.
A second complaint was filed on June 10th in Jackson County District Court charging Ewing with similar offenses occurring in September 2014. He was arrested on a $75,000 bond, which he posted the same day
Miller says despite the state’s objection, a judge Friday morning modified Ewing’s $150,000 bond in the latest case to an O.R. bond.
As part of the conditions of his bond, Ewing must be electronically monitored, have no (social) contact, direct or indirect, with any non-relative female and abstain from drug or alcohol use.
Ewing is scheduled to make a first appearance on all three cases Monday morning.
Jackson County Sheriff Tim Morse says the sheriff's department is actively involved in the investigations which are ongoing.
